From the North(O’Hare, Wisconsin, Northern Suburbs):
Tri-State Tollway South (294) to the 22nd Street (Cermak Road) West exit, which will be on your right after passing through the Cermak Road tollbooth. Turn off onto ramp, and bear left (west) onto West 22nd Street (Cermak Road). After approximately .4 miles turn right onto York Road. Take York for approximately 1.6 miles to Butterfield Road (State Road 56), and turn left (west). At the next stoplight, Prospect Avenue, you will see the school on your left.
From the South (Southern Suburbs, Indiana):
Tri-State Tollway (294) to the Roosevelt Road (Route 38) West exit. Right on Roosevelt Road to York Road North exit. Take York Road to Butterfield Road (Route 56) West. Left (west) on Butterfield to stoplight at Prospect Road, where you’ll see the school. Turn left on Prospect, and the school is on your immediate left.
From the East (Chicago):
The Eisenhower Expressway (I-290) to Roosevelt Road exit. Roosevelt Road west to York Road North exit. Take York Road to Butterfield Road (Route 56) West. Left (west) on Butterfield to stoplight at Prospect Road, where you’ll see the school. Turn left on Prospect, and the school is on your immediate left.
From the West (Western Suburbs):
Butterfield Road East past Drury Lane Oak Brook to the stoplight at Prospect Road. Turn right, and the school will be on your immediate left.
The Campus:
The Elementary and Middle Schools are at the north end of the campus. A driveway runs between these buildings and the High School building, which occupies the south end of campus. Guest parking is along the driveway and at the south and east of the High School.
The Office of the Superintendent is located at the north end of the High School building, with an entrance along Prospect Avenue. This office also serves as the central office for transacting business with the school.
